Abstract
We report optical parametric oscillators (OPO) based on periodically poled KTiOPO4, pumped by nanosecond 532 nm pulses, and capable of delivering 5 mJ pulse energy. The OPO output could be tuned from 756–771 nm (signal) and 1.72–1.80 µm (idler), with peak efficiencies of up to 37% (signal) and 8% (idler). Monolithic OPO oscillation and single frequency operation with an instrument limited optical bandwidth of 250 MHz are also demonstrated.
